Major $40 Million Verdict Against Johnson & Johnson: What It Means for Women Diagnosed With Cancer

Breaking News: A Landmark Verdict for Women Harmed by Talcum Powder

Beasley Allen recently secured a $40 million trial verdict against Johnson & Johnson in a case involving talcum powder and its connection to ovarian cancer. This is a powerful and important step forward for women and families seeking accountability from one of the world’s largest corporations.

For years, women have used talcum powder in the genital area without any warning that it could increase the risk of ovarian, fallopian tube, or primary peritoneal cancer. This recent verdict reinforces what many victims already know all too well—this product has caused real harm, and Johnson & Johnson must be held responsible.
